Transaction 73f6f221fec386bfefe24c1eaec1fd84ed1604989b6e2530e77b1f1c33ed9b7f

1 Input
2 Outputs
  • 73f6f221fec386bfefe24c1eaec1fd84ed1604989b6e2530e77b1f1c33ed9b7f:0
  • value  2829427
    address  3PUv9tQMSDCEPSMsYSopA5wDW86pwRFbNF
  • 73f6f221fec386bfefe24c1eaec1fd84ed1604989b6e2530e77b1f1c33ed9b7f:1
  • value  39034563
    address  bc1q82ce3nfaxd8gj6jaxsy346pl309qr6w2qyj8apy5e3kel49uvf6sdy65wa